Transaction 3d00ac0f3217e4f4f6f0e5b0795e6a1b23a9f84ff4b0f105a3778bc5e443a344

47 Input
1 Outputs
  • 3d00ac0f3217e4f4f6f0e5b0795e6a1b23a9f84ff4b0f105a3778bc5e443a344:0
  • value  5188080
    address  3N4vQhYMQqDemP33A2gbriVqv5zDijLKQv